Abstract

The article presents thermodynamic calculations of decomposition reactions of carbohydrates and their derivatives under the action of concentrated sulfuric acid. The conducted experiments showed the possibility of rubber decomposition with the formation of carbonaceous matter and sulfur dioxide, which is used to obtain sulfuric acid.
